1972 Chevy C10 "OrngsikL"

About 2 weeks ago, I sold my 2008 GMC extended cab short bed, dropped 4/6. To fund this project. (no more note either!!)

Found the truck on craigslist in Mississippi, contacted the PO a few times by email. Me and a good buddy left one morning, with a trailer, and me full of doughnuts and redbull, after working nights to go get it. I was tired, but it was worth the drive.

here's a shot of the craigslist ad.


took about 2.5 hours to get there from home, we rolled up and seen it, checked it out and took it for a few spins.


loaded it up and headed back home, had a guy ask to buy it at the gas station in mississippi. But we kept on rolling.



I couldn't stop looking behind the truck, It was like christmas morning.

Got the truck home.



She's got some rust, but not much.





Not sure what the steering wheel came out of? Pontiac??


I think i've had it about two weeks. Since then i've checked all the rear lights, got them working. Pulled the dent out of the drivers door, not perfect, but just for the time being, we wanted to see how bad it was and I will have to replace it.

Got the coolant temp and battery voltage aftermarket gauges hooked up to make sure all that is working. Truck runs a 160 with airflow and 190 idling, so i'm good there. Battery voltage shoots up to about 16V while cruising and around 12V while idling, not sure of this is right or if the gauge is off a bit?? Haven't hooked up my volt meter to the line yet. Had an oil leak at the sending unit line going to the gauge in the cluster, it was loose, tightened it up and no more oil leak. The oil dip stick was leaking too, needed an o-ring. Replaced the driver side motor mount a few days ago.
Overall the truck runs damn good. Took it on about a 30 mile trip the other day and the only problem I had was the voltage gauge started bouncing from 12 to 18v, pulled over and we smelled something burning, but couldn't find anything smoking or wires hot to the touch. Got back in and kept going with no more issues. I had a fire extinguisher in the truck just in case..haha.

Motor is a 350 with a mild cam, holley 650 carb, edelbrock intake and some longtubes going into dual flowmasters. It lopes real good. I don't know anything about the internals. History on the motor is that it was in a monte carlo SS that the PO was friends with the owner and the owner of the mcss wanted a big block right after he finished this engine, so the PO got it and swapped it in, said to have 30k on the motor.

The transmission is a th-350. Said to have been rebuilt recently. We used an online calcualtor based off of mph from my phone gps (dash gauge is working but not accurate, off by about 10-15 mph) and i'm thinking the rear end had around 4.10 gears.

Ordered a few parts the other day from sokyclassics.com
Got a turn signal cam, gear shift indicator and all the parts that make it function, front bumper hardware, electrical wiring manual and hood stop bumpers.

Got bored the other day before pulling the dent and layed some paint on the tailgate



I've been pinstriping for about 3 years now but it's been a full year since i've pinstriped anything. Gotta get back in it.

Re: 1972 Chevy C10 "OrngsikL"

ok more progress.



turn signals wern't canceling. ordered some new parts from sokyclassics.com and installed em. one side will cancel now but the other will not. i went to oreilly's and bought their help kit and it doesn't fit, so i tired using the springs from the kit, still didn't work. Went to napa to try and buy just the springs, well, they don't sell them anymore. so i'll play with that later.

drove the truck to work, about a 20 mile trip to work, and it did well.

hooked up the pcv system, had to order a special 90* fitting from edelbrock that goes into the top of the intake manifold. while doing that, i finished it all up and was going to put the carb back on and one of the lug studs stripped out, so i got to use a heli-coil for the first time. Worked very good!
So, got all that back on and working good.

Got a call on 11/1/11 that my title and plate was in and went pick them up.

Last week, I took a trip to Kelly's (sharpshooter)'s house and he had an extra front bumper. Picked it up, came home and installed it and fixed some chaffed wires and got the turn signals working. On the way home, I stopped in Port Allen at Love's truckstop and picked up some mexican blankets, i'll get a pic soon.(I'll rewire the whole truck when it's apart)



Took the truck on a few more local trips. I kept hearing this slapping noise that was speeding up as the truck was accelerating. I thought it was a u-joint, but it wasn't. Took the left rear drum off and a chunk of shoe fell out...time to do rear brakes

Didn't take any after pics, everyone knows what that looks like. Truck stops 500% better now, haha. Glad I got that fixed.

Re: 1972 Chevy C10 "OrngsikL"

Got some parts in. Waiting til after xmas to see what else comes in and ill post it all up at once.

Since i brought the truck home, its always leaned down on the right front, come to find out the driver spring wasnt in the pocket at the top, so i popped the lower balljoint out of the lca and repositioned the spring, put about 100a miles on her last saturday. More to come soon!
